Top 10 Tips For Assessing The Risk Management And Size Of A Position For An Ai Stock Trading Predictor
Achieving effective risk management and position sizing are crucial to an effective AI stock trading predictor. Properly managed they can help minimize losses and increase return. Here are 10 tips to consider these factors:
1. How to Use Stop-Loss & Take-Profit Levels
Why: These levels can aid in limiting losses, as well as ensure the potential for profits. They also limit exposure to the extreme fluctuations of the market.
What to do: Determine whether the model is based on dynamic take-profit and stop-loss rules that are based on the market's volatility or other risk factors. Models which have adaptive thresholds will perform better when markets are volatile and can help avoid excessive drawdowns.

2. Examine the risk-to-reward ratio and consider its implications.
Why: An optimal balance of risk to reward will ensure that the potential for profit outweighs risk, which supports long-term returns.

3. Check the maximum drawdown restrictions
What's the reason? Limiting drawdowns can prevent the model from suffering huge losses which are hard to recover.
What to do: Ensure that the model includes the drawdown limit (e.g. 10 percent). This constraint will help reduce volatility over time and help protect your capital, especially in times of market volatility.

Review Position Size Strategies Based on Portfolio-Risk
What is the reason: The size of the position determines how much capital will be allotted to each trade. It balances returns and the risk.
How: Check whether the model is using risk-based size that allows the model to adjust the size of the position according to fluctuation of the asset, risk to trade or portfolio risk. The ability to adjust the size of a position can result in more balanced portfolios and less risk.

5. Find out about the sizing of positions that are adjusted for volatility.
Why: Volatility Adjusted Sizing (VAS) means taking larger positions in low-volatility assets, as well as smaller positions for more volatile assets. This improves stability.
Check the model's volatility-adjusted method. This could be the ATR or the standard deviation. This will ensure that you are exposed to risk across all trades.

6. Diversification in Asset Classes and Sectors
Why? Diversification reduces risk by spreading investments across sectors or asset categories.
Check that the model has been programmed to diversify investment portfolios, especially in markets that are volatile. A well-diversified portfolio will be able to minimize losses in downturns within a particular sector but still remain stable.

7. Evaluation of the use of dynamic Hedging strategies
Hedging can be a method to protect capital from adverse market movements by minimising exposure.
What to do: Ensure that the model is utilizing dynamic hedging methods, such ETFs and options. Hedging is a good strategy to stabilize performance, especially in turbulent markets.

8. Determine Adaptive Risk Limits based on Market Conditions
The reason is that market conditions are different, so fixed risk limits may not be appropriate in all situations.
What should you do: Make sure that the model is automatically adjusting its risk limits in response to market volatility and mood. Flexible risk limits enable the model to accept more risk in markets that are stable and reduce exposure in uncertain times, while preserving capital.

9. Monitor in real-time the risk of the Portfolio Risk
What's the reason? Real-time risk management allows the model to respond instantly to market changes, minimizing the risk of losses.
How to find tools which monitor real-time metrics, such as Value at Risk (VaR), or drawdown percentages. A model that has live monitoring is in a position to respond to market changes that are sudden and minimize your risk exposure.

Review Stress Testing and Scenario Analysis of Extreme Events
Why stress tests are important: They help predict the model’s performance under adverse conditions like financial crisis.
How do you verify that the model's resiliency has been evaluated against previous financial or market crises. The scenario analysis makes sure that the model is resilient enough to endure downturns as well as sudden fluctuations in the economic environment.
With these suggestions to evaluate the reliability of an AI trading model's risk management and sizing method. A model with a well-rounded strategy should be able to manage dynamically risk and reward in order to achieve consistent returns under various market conditions. 10 Tips For Evaluating An Investment App That Makes Use Of An Ai Stock Trade Predictor
In order to determine if an app uses AI to predict the price of stocks, you need to evaluate several factors. This includes its capabilities, reliability, and alignment with investment goals. These 10 best suggestions will assist you in evaluating an app.
1. Assessment of the AI Model Accuracy and Performance
The AI stock trading forecaster's effectiveness is dependent on its precision.
How: Check historical performance indicators like accuracy rates precision, recall, and accuracy. Check backtesting results to determine how well the AI model performed in various market conditions.

2. Review Data Sources and Quality
What's the reason? AI models' predictions are only as accurate as the data they are based on.
How: Evaluate the source of data used in the app, such as current market data or historical data, or news feeds. Apps should use high-quality data from reliable sources.

3. Review the User Experience Design and Interface Design
What's the reason? A simple interface is essential to navigate and make it easy for new investors especially.
How to review the layout design, layout, and the overall user experience. You should look for features like easy navigation, intuitive interfaces and compatibility on all platforms.

4. Verify that algorithms are transparent and predictions
Understanding the AI's predictions will give you confidence in their predictions.
Find the documentation which explains the algorithm and the variables taken into account in making predictions. Transparent models are often able to increase the confidence of users.

5. You can also personalize and tailor your order.
The reason: Different investors have different strategies for investing and risk appetites.
How to: Look for an application that permits you to customize settings to suit your goals for investing. Also, think about whether it is compatible with your risk tolerance and preferred investment style. Personalization enhances the accuracy of AI's predictions.

6. Review Risk Management Features
The reason: It is crucial to safeguard capital by managing risk efficiently.
How: Check that the app has instruments for managing risk, such as stop-loss orders and diversification strategies to portfolios. Analyzing how these features integrate with AI predictions.

7. Examine community and support features
Why: Access to customer support and community insights can enhance the investor experience.
How: Look for forums, discussion groups, and social trading components that allow users to exchange ideas. Customer support must be evaluated to determine if it is available and responsive.

8. Verify that you are Regulatory and Security Compliant. Features
What is the reason? It is essential to ensure that the app is legal and protects user interests.
How: Verify that the app meets relevant financial regulations and has solid security measures implemented, including encryption and methods for securing authentication.

9. Take a look at Educational Resources and Tools
Why: Education resources can improve your investment knowledge and aid you in making more informed choices.
How: Look for educational materials like tutorials or webinars to help explain AI prediction and investing concepts.

10. Read User Reviews and Testimonials.
What is the reason: Feedback from customers is an excellent method to gain a better understanding of the app, its performance and reliability.
How to: Read user reviews on app stores as well as financial sites to evaluate the user's experience. You can find patterns by studying the reviews about the app's features, performance and support.
These guidelines will assist you in evaluating the app that makes use of an AI prediction of stock prices to make sure that it is suitable for your needs and lets you make educated decisions about stock market.
